The Army DACM Office currently sponsors Naval Postgraduate School attendance in two different disciplines: Master of Science in Financial Management (MSFM Curriculum 857) and Master of Science in Acquisition – Program Management (MSA-PM Curriculum 836).

These 24-month graduate degree programs are part-time, distance learning opportunities.  The online instruction brings the classes to the students, permitting students to continue supporting the mission of their Command/Agency.

Master of Science in Acquisition – Program Management (MSA-PM Curriculum 836)

The Master of Science in Acquisition – Program Management (MSA-PM, Curriculum 836) educates students to be acquisition program managers and leaders of people and resources within federal organizations. Graduates gain the leadership and decision-making skills necessary to effectively deliver warfighting capabilities by balancing program cost, schedule, technical performance, risk and supportability. No previous program management experience is required for admission.

Eligibility:

Civilian Acquisition Workforce GS-12 through GS-15 or broadband/pay band equivalent.

Announcement Dates:

Application period opens: 2 February 2026
Application period closes: 10 March 2026
NPS Online Application Deadline: 4 March 2026
Cohort Dates: 7 July 2026 – 30 June 2028

Master of Science in Financial Management (MSFM Curriculum 857)

The Master of Science in Financial Management (MSFM-Curriculum 857) educates students with the latest knowledge and skills in defense-focused financial management. The program supports continuous financial management reform initiatives mandated by Congress and senior leaders, with a focus on efficient and effective expenditure of public funds. Graduates also earn an NPS graduate-level academic certificate: DoD Financial Management with both the Data Analytics Track and the Audit Track (Curriculum 196).

Eligibility:

Civilian Acquisition Workforce GS-12 through GS-15 or broadband/pay band equivalent.

Announcement Dates:

Application period opens: September 14, 2026
Application period closes: October 22, 2026
NPS Online Application Deadline: October 15, 2026
Cohort Dates: March 30, 2027 – March 30, 2029
